Senior Software Engineer Back-End (Go)

AUTODOC is the largest and fastest growing auto parts ecommerce platform in Europe.
Present across 27 countries with around 5,000 employees, AUTODOC generated revenue of over €1.3 billion in 2023, supplying more than 7.4 million active customers with its 5.8 million vehicle parts and accessories for car, truck, and motorcycle brands.
Curious minds, adventurous experts and tech-savvy professionals - one team, one billion euros revenue. Catch the ride!

 

The Senior Go Developer will play a pivotal role in developing and maintaining our distributed user behavior analytics and e-commerce tracking system. This professional will be responsible for multiple services ensuring high performance, reliability, and scalability of the entire system, enabling company to gain valuable insights into user behavior for data-driven decision-making.


Responsibilities:

  • Software development: design, develop, and maintain scalable services, focusing on high-performance event processing, data collection, and analytics systems
  • Architecture management: contribute to the evolution of our distributed system architecture, ensuring proper integration between services, effective event processing, and data flow optimization
  • System monitoring: implement comprehensive monitoring, logging, and tracing to ensure system health and performance
  • Security and compliance: ensure proper implementation of security measures for user data handling and session management
  • Performance optimization: identify and resolve performance bottlenecks across the distributed system, optimizing data collection and processing workflows for large-scale analytics
  • Technical leadership: conduct code reviews, provide mentorship, and contribute to technical decision-making across multiple services
  • Collaborate with distributed team members across different time zone


Qualifications:

  • Minimum of 5 years of professional software development experience, with at least 3 years focused on Go:
    - Deep understanding of Go concurrency patterns (goroutines, channels, context)
    - Experience with async processing and concurrent data handling
    - Proficiency in implementing thread-safe data structures
  • Strong expertise in distributed systems, including experience with:
    - Event-driven architectures and message queuing (Kafka)
    - gRPC and Protocol Buffers
    - RESTful APIs and WebSocket implementations
  • Infrastructure and DevOps skills:
    - Docker containerization and orchestration
    - GitLab CI/CD pipelines
    - Experience with cloud platforms and understanding of cloud pricing models
  • Monitoring and Observability:
    - OpenTelemetry for distributed tracing
    - Prometheus metrics and Grafana dashboards
  • Problem-solving skills: excellent problem-solving and debugging skills, with a keen eye for detail
  • English level: Intermediate


Will be as a plus:

  • High-load distributed systems
  • Traffic analysis and bot detection
  • Data warehousing solutions (particularly Snowflake)
  • Security best practices for session management

 

We offer:

  • Stable employment in the fast-growing international company 
  • International career in a multicultural environment with lots of opportunities to grow 
  • Annual vacation of 28 calendar days and 1 additional day off on your birthday
  • Health Insurance for access to various high-quality medical services (doctor visits, diagnostics, medical treatment)
  • Mental Wellbeing Program – the opportunity for free psychological counseling for you and your family members 24/7 hotline and online sessions
  • Opportunities for advancement, further trainings (over 650 courses on soft and hard skills on our e-learning platform) and coaching
  • Free English and German language classes
  • Flexible working hours and hybrid work 

 

Join us today and let’s create a success story together!

164 views
Β·
6 applications
100% read
Β·
100% responded
Last responded 4 days ago
72 views
Β·
2 applications
100% read
Β·
100% responded
Last responded 4 days ago
To apply for this and other jobs on Djinni login or signup.

Similar jobs

Countries of Europe or Ukraine
Countries of Europe or Ukraine
Countries of Europe or Ukraine